Long Beach, N.Y., Dec. 2, 2012 -- Maverick, provides comfort to disaster survivors, Ashley Mejilla and Cassidy Sabel at a FEMA Disaster Recovery Center (DRC) in Long Beach, New York. The Good Dog Foundation provides therapy dogs to assist in many kinds of stressful situations. FEMA sets up DRC's in affected neighborhoods to help residents with their disaster recovery.
